Wren & Cuff Box of War review
Back on the russian path! I had some issues with this purchase, I got one from Germany and it didn’t work.. But in about 2 weeks I got back my money and I got another from The Effect Factory in France. HOW IT LOOKS Wren&Cuff pedals are incredible. The BoW Read more…